Dear RN Program Applicant:
We have received your TEAS test results and you are now eligible for selection for the Fall 2015 College of the Canyons RN Program. The selection is scheduled for mid-April and you will receive an email (your COC email) at that time as to whether or not you were selected.
HOLD THE DATE: IF you are selected, you must attend a mandatory orientation scheduled for Friday, May 1, 2015 – 8 am – 12:30 pm.

We will find out around April 15th if we got picked. We were told there were about 200 applicants and the top 50 would be chosen. They said not to bother checking your email or worrying about it during spring break because they would not release that information before the 15th. I'm super nervous. Good luck to everyone!
Thank you! I started studying for the test at the beginning of January until I took the test. I thoroughly studied ATI's "Study Manual for the Test of Essential Academic Skills (TEAS) Version V", I practiced all five tests in McGraw-Hill "5 TEAS Practice Tests" book, I purchased and took both test A & B that ATI offers online ($44 each), and after doing all that I went on YouTube and found "folders" of a lot of TEAS Test V Prep videos and watched all the ones I was weak in. Those videos helped me big time! I highly recommend them.
